The spirit and aim of this book is to present a compact introduction to the basic combinatorial tools - such as recurrence relations, generating functions, incidence matrices, and the inclusion-exclusion principle - that will give the reader a flavour of the distinctive characteristics of this attractive and increasingly important branch of mathematics. In this new edition, Steiner triple systems are constructed and S(5,8,24) is obtained via the Golay code of length 24; also included is an application of the marriage theorem to score sequences of tournaments.
